One of the most common issues that can arise with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to open or lock. This usually happens when the locking mechanism has become stiff or jammed. You can grease your lock and handle with graphite or machine oil. This will allow for the mechanism to be unlocked and the door or window to function as normal.

Another issue that can be found with uPVC windows is that the hinges get stiff or stuck. This problem is commonly caused by dust and grit that build up on the hinges over time. Lubricating the hinges with oil or grease is the solution. The wrong grease, however, could lead to damage and may render the hinges inoperable.

Repairs to stained glass

Stained glass windows can be found in homes, churches and other buildings. They add visual interest as well as privacy and light to the space. However, they are quite fragile and need to be kept in good order to keep them in good shape. Even with the most careful treatment stained glass and lead windows can become damaged due to the aging process, exposure to weather and environmental elements. This can cause a variety of problems such as cracks, fade and water leakage. On average, the cost for fixing broken or cracked stained glass is approximately $500. The cost will differ based on the method required to resolve the issue. For instance professional technicians may use cop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ing to fix the glass that has broken. They can also re-lead lead cames and reseal the stained glass. There are several alternatives each with distinct advantages and costs. The best choice is based on the size, location, and the type of glass that is used.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, building movement or just normal wear and tear. As time passes, cracks can grow and cause more problems. A crack that is located on a key element or on the face of stained glass panels should be repaired as soon as it is possible to avoid further enlargement and damage. Years ago, this was usually done by splicing the "Dutchman" lead flange over the crack. This method was not a great solution, and today there are much better methods to repair these kinds of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a specific art that can take many forms. It could be as simple as repairing a crack, or as complex as the restoration of the stained glass door panel or window back to its original condition. In general, the cost of restoration projects is much higher than a simple repair or replacement. The work includes cleaning and removing damaged glass, tightening lead cames, resealing the cement and re-tying it and replacing stained glass pieces that are missing.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through gaps that surround windows and doors. It's an essential element of home maintenance, and can help avoid the need for costly repairs or energy bills, as well as make a home more comfortable. The materials used to make the seal may degrade over time, as a result of wear and tears. It is essential to replace these materials periodically.

You can determine whether your weather stripping has been damaged by noticing a wet spot after washing your windows, a whistling sound when driving down the road or a draft you feel when you are in front of a closed-door. Taskers can make use of various weatherstripping materials to seal your windows and doors. Foam tapes are made from closed or open-cell foam and are available in a variety of thicknesses, widths, and quality to accommodate every kind of crack. These are easy-to-install and are easily cut by cutting. Felt strips aren't expensive and last for at least a year. You can cut them to size using scissors, and then attach them to the door frame or hinge side of the sliding window using glue, staples or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ips can be a little more complicated to install but they can be nailed in place along a window jamb.
